Player’s Career

Nani began his football journey at Sporting CP, where he showcased his talents as a young winger. His impressive performances caught the attention of Manchester United, leading to a transfer in 2007. Upon joining the Red Devils, Nani aimed to fill the shoes of legendary players. Over the next eight seasons, he became an integral part of the squad. He made a total of 230 appearances and scored 40 goals for the club. His pace and skill made him a constant threat on the wing, exciting fans and distracting defenders.
